Accessible Parking Space - Kersdale Avenue

The decision

2022-02-24 · Etobicoke York Community Council · adopted

As filed

The Etobicoke York Community Council: 1. Designated an on-street accessible parking space on the north side of Kersdale Avenue, between a point 42.3 metres east of Kane Avenue and a point 5.5 metres further east.

On the agenda

As the city filed it

This staff report is about a matter that Community Council has delegated authority from City Council to make a final decision. Transportation Services is requesting approval for the installation of an on-street accessible parking space on the north side of Kersdale Avenue.

Staff recommended

The Director, Traffic Management, Transportation Services recommends that: 1. Etobicoke York Community Council designate an on-street accessible parking space on the north side of Kersdale Avenue, between a point 42.3 metres east of Kane Avenue and a point 5.5 metres further east.
